Hiking around Höganäs, located on the Kullaberg Peninsula, offers diverse natural landscapes where the sea meets land. The region is characterized by dramatic coastal cliffs providing expansive sea views, particularly within the Kullaberg Nature Reserve. Beyond the coastline, hikers encounter lush forests and rolling landscapes. This area provides varied terrain for hiking, from rugged coastal paths to serene wooded trails.

Best hiking trails around Höganäs

  • The most popular hiking route is Skåneleden: Kullaberg Peninsula Loop, a 12.9 miles (20.7 km) trail that takes about 6 hours to complete, traversing dramatic coastal cliffs and offering continuous ocean vistas.
  • Another top favourite among local hikers is From Arild to Mölle - Skåneleden SL5 (Stage 3), a moderate 10.1 miles (16.2 km) path. This route leads through coastal areas, forests, and picturesque fishing villages.
  • Local hikers also love the View from Kullaberg – View from Åkersberget loop from Kullabergs naturreservat, a 5.5 miles (8.9 km) trail leading through the Kullaberg Nature Reserve, often completed in about 2 hours 40 minutes.

Arild is a charming seaside village at the foot of Kullaberg, with colorful houses, cute lanes and a small harbor that makes it a perfect scenic pause during every hike.

Nabben Nature Reserve is a rugged coastal heath on the Kulla peninsula (Skälderviken), with rocky shorelines, ancient Bronze Age mounds and rich birdlife – a perfect and peaceful detour along Skåneleden.

There are two main hiking trails in Kullaberg Nature Reserve: the red and the blue. The red trail runs along a long stretch of the southern coast, as seen here. As the terrain slopes down to the sea, you can enjoy breathtaking views almost the entire time while hiking, as is the case at this viewpoint.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available around Höganäs?

Höganäs offers a wide variety of hiking experiences, with nearly 120 distinct routes. These range from easy strolls to more challenging coastal paths, ensuring options for all skill levels.

What kind of landscapes can I expect to see while hiking in Höganäs?

Hiking in Höganäs provides a diverse natural experience. You'll encounter dramatic coastal cliffs with breathtaking sea views, especially within the Kullaberg Nature Reserve. Beyond the coast, trails lead through lush beech forests and rolling landscapes, offering a different natural setting.

Are there any easy hiking trails suitable for beginners or families?

Yes, Höganäs has over 50 easy hiking routes perfect for beginners or families. These trails often lead through forests or along less strenuous coastal sections. For a moderate option that's still family-friendly, consider the View from Kullaberg – View from Åkersberget loop, which is about 8.9 km long and explores the Kullaberg Nature Reserve.

Are there any circular hiking routes in the Höganäs area?

Yes, circular routes are available. A notable option is the Skåneleden: Kullaberg Peninsula Loop, which is a challenging 20.7 km trail offering continuous ocean vistas. There are also shorter loop options within the Kullaberg Nature Reserve.

What are some notable landmarks or attractions to see along the hiking trails?

The region is rich with points of interest. You can hike to Kullens Fyr Lighthouse, Scandinavia's brightest lighthouse at the tip of Kullaberg. Other unique sights include the Nimis Driftwood Sculpture and the Silver Cave (Silvergrottan). Many trails also pass through picturesque fishing villages like Lerhamn.

Can I hike parts of the Skåneleden trail near Höganäs?

Absolutely. The Kullaleden (Skåneleden SL 5) is a highlight for hikers in Höganäs, offering world-class coastal experiences. You can explore stages like From Arild to Mölle - Skåneleden SL5 (Stage 3) or the Skåneleden Trail 5, Stage 5: Höganäs-Domsten, which lead through diverse landscapes including coastal areas, forests, and charming villages.

What do other hikers say about the trails in Höganäs?

The hiking routes in Höganäs are highly regarded by the komoot community, holding an average rating of 4.7 stars from over 1500 reviews. Hikers frequently praise the dramatic coastal scenery, the well-maintained paths, and the variety of landscapes from rugged cliffs to serene forests.

Are there any trails that offer views of lakes or other water features besides the sea?

While the sea views are prominent, some trails in the broader Höganäs area can lead you to tranquil lakes. For instance, you might find paths near Kobberdammen, a peaceful lake that offers a different kind of water-based scenery.

What is the best season for hiking in Höganäs?

The best season for hiking in Höganäs is generally spring through autumn (April to October), when the weather is milder and the natural beauty is in full bloom or displaying vibrant autumn colors. Summer offers longer daylight hours, but spring and autumn provide comfortable temperatures and fewer crowds.

Are there any challenging routes for experienced hikers?

Yes, for experienced hikers seeking a challenge, Höganäs offers several difficult routes. The Skåneleden: Kullaberg Peninsula Loop is a demanding 20.7 km trail that traverses rugged coastal cliffs and requires a good level of fitness. There are 20 difficult routes in total to explore.

How long do hikes typically take in Höganäs?

Hiking durations vary significantly depending on the route's length and difficulty. Shorter, easy trails might take an hour or two, while moderate routes like the View from Kullaberg – View from Åkersberget loop can take around 2 hours 40 minutes. Longer, more challenging trails such as the Skåneleden: Kullaberg Peninsula Loop can take up to 6 hours to complete.

Is public transport available to reach trailheads in Höganäs?

Höganäs and the Kullaberg Peninsula are generally well-connected by local bus services, which can provide access to various towns and villages where trailheads are located. It's advisable to check local transport schedules for specific routes and stops that align with your chosen hike.
